RE: The tariff classification of a solar panel kit from China

Dear Ms. Purcell:

In your letter dated October 21, 2011 you requested a tariff classification ruling.

The product you plan to import is identified as a Solar-on-Demand Integrated Solar Panel Kit, item number M20653. An instruction manual and a representative sample were included with your submission. The sample will be returned to you as requested.

The solar panel kit is designed for use with solar powered garden fountains. It includes a Solar-on-Demand panel with an on/off switch, a rechargeable battery, a submersible pump, two spray nozzles, short tubing and a tier kit and allows users to run the fountain day or night. The fountain will operate throughout the day and store any excess power in the battery. The unit can also be charged during the day to power the fountain for nighttime use. The pump will continue to run until the battery needs to be recharged.

Based on the information provided, we find that the solar panel kit is a composite good of which the essential character is imparted by the submersible pump which circulates the water through the fountain. Submersible pumps are provided for in heading 8413,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TSUS).

The applicable subheading for the Solar-on-Demand Integrated Solar Panel Kit will be 8413.70.2004, HTSUS, which provides for submersible pumps as other centrifugal pumps for liquids. The rate of duty is free.
